One of the four entrances to the Alhambra in Granada is through the Gate of Justice, also known as the Gate of the Esplanade. It features an impressive horseshoe arch. Built during the reign of Sultan Yusuf I in the 14th century, it is believed that its original purpose was to serve as the main entrance to the Alhambra, symbolizing power and authority. It is considered the largest of the Nasrid gate-towers.

Nasrid origin (11th century): it served the old Azitini Mosque and was supplied by the Aynadamar irrigation ditch, a sophisticated Andalusian hydraulic system. Christian reconstruction (17th century): on top of the original Muslim cistern, next to the current Church of San Nicolás. The current structure dates from 1646 according to Henríquez de Jorquera.

Frequently Asked Questions

Which castles offer the most significant historical insights around Pulianas?

The Alhambra in Granada City is unparalleled, showcasing a rich history as a Moorish palace and fortress complex from the 13th century, with additions like the Palace of Carlos V after the Christian conquest. Other significant sites include Moclín Castle, a crucial frontier fortress of the Nasrid kingdom, and Almuñécar Castle, which has origins dating back to Phoenician and Roman times, later serving the Nasrid dynasty.

Are there any lesser-known or 'hidden gem' castles worth exploring?

While the Alhambra is world-renowned, Lanjarón Castle Ruins offer a glimpse into medieval history away from the main crowds. Although in ruins, its strategic location overlooking the Lanjarón River valley and its history from the Nasrid and Christian periods make it an interesting, less-traveled site. Moclín Castle is another significant historical site that played a crucial role in the Nasrid kingdom's defense.

Are there any castles with unique architectural features?

The Alhambra is renowned for its intricate Islamic architecture, particularly within the Nasrid Palaces and the Partal Palace, featuring detailed stucco work, tile mosaics, and serene courtyards with water features. Almuñécar Castle also showcases clear Moorish origins, later enhanced with 16th-century defensive structures like a moat and drawbridge.

What is the history behind the Tower of the Captive within the Alhambra complex?

The Tower of the Captive, located on the rampart walkway of the Alhambra, was historically known as Torre de la Ladrona and de la Sultana. Its current name comes from the legend that Doña Isabel de Solís, who converted to Islam and became Zoraya, a favorite of King Muley Hacén, resided there. It's a fascinating example of the personal stories intertwined with the fortress's history.
